use crate::Result;
use crate::cli::logs::print_startup_logs;
use crate::daemon::RunOptions;
use crate::ipc::client::IpcClient;
use crate::pitchfork_toml::PitchforkToml;
use chrono::{DateTime, Local};
use miette::ensure;
use std::sync::Arc;
/// Restarts a daemon (stops then starts it)
#[derive(Debug, clap::Args)]
#[clap(
verbatim_doc_comment,
long_about = "\
Restarts a daemon (stops then starts it)
Sends SIGTERM to stop the daemon, then starts it again from the
pitchfork.toml configuration.
Examples:
pitchfork restart api Restart a single daemon
pitchfork restart api worker Restart multiple daemons
pitchfork restart --all Restart all running daemons"
)]
pub struct Restart {
/// ID of the daemon(s) to restart
id: Vec<String>,
/// Restart all running daemons
#[clap(long, short)]
all: bool,
/// Suppress startup log output
#[clap(short, long)]
quiet: bool,
}
impl Restart {
pub async fn run(&self) -> Result<()> {
ensure!(
self.all || !self.id.is_empty(),
"You must provide at least one daemon to restart, or use --all"
);
let pt = PitchforkToml::all_merged();
let ipc = Arc::new(IpcClient::connect(true).await?);
// Determine which daemons to restart
let disabled_daemons = ipc.get_disabled_daemons().await?;
let ids: Vec<String> = if self.all {
// Get all running daemons that are in config
// (ad-hoc daemons started via `pitchfork run` cannot be restarted from config)
let active = ipc.active_daemons().await?;
active
.into_iter()
.filter(|d| d.pid.is_some() && pt.daemons.contains_key(&d.id))
.map(|d| d.id)
.collect()
} else {
// Validate all specified daemons BEFORE stopping any of them
// to avoid terminating daemons that cannot be restarted
let mut valid_ids = Vec::new();
for id in &self.id {
if !pt.daemons.contains_key(id) {
warn!(
"Daemon {} not found in config (ad-hoc daemons cannot be restarted), skipping",
id
);
continue;
}
if disabled_daemons.contains(id) {
warn!("Daemon {} is disabled, skipping", id);
continue;
}
valid_ids.push(id.clone());
}
valid_ids
};
if ids.is_empty() {
info!("No daemons to restart");
return Ok(());
}
// Stop all daemons first (all have been validated as restartable)
for id in &ids {
if let Err(e) = ipc.stop(id.clone()).await {
warn!("Failed to stop daemon {}: {}", id, e);
}
}
// Brief delay to allow processes to terminate
tokio::time::sleep(tokio::time::Duration::from_millis(500)).await;
// Start all daemons
let mut tasks = Vec::new();
for id in ids {
// Already validated above, but --all path still needs this check
if self.all && disabled_daemons.contains(&id) {
continue;
}
let daemon_data = match pt.daemons.get(&id) {
Some(d) => {
let run = d.run.clone();
let auto_stop = d
.auto
.contains(&crate::pitchfork_toml::PitchforkTomlAuto::Stop);
let dir = d
.path
.as_ref()
.and_then(|p| p.parent())
.map(|p| p.to_path_buf())
.unwrap_or_default();
let cron_schedule = d.cron.as_ref().map(|c| c.schedule.clone());
let cron_retrigger = d.cron.as_ref().map(|c| c.retrigger);
let retry = d.retry;
let ready_delay = d.ready_delay;
let ready_output = d.ready_output.clone();
let ready_http = d.ready_http.clone();
let ready_port = d.ready_port;
let depends = d.depends.clone();
(
run,
auto_stop,
dir,
cron_schedule,
cron_retrigger,
retry,
ready_delay,
ready_output,
ready_http,
ready_port,
depends,
)
}
None => {
warn!("Daemon {} not found in config, skipping", id);
continue;
}
};
let (
run,
auto_stop,
dir,
cron_schedule,
cron_retrigger,
retry,
ready_delay,
ready_output,
ready_http,
ready_port,
depends,
) = daemon_data;
let ipc_clone = ipc.clone();
let task = tokio::spawn(async move {
let cmd = match shell_words::split(&run) {
Ok(c) => c,
Err(e) => {
error!("Failed to parse command for daemon {}: {}", id, e);
return (id, None, Some(1));
}
};
let start_time = Local::now();
let (actually_started, exit_code) = match ipc_clone
.run(RunOptions {
id: id.clone(),
cmd,
shell_pid: None,
force: false,
autostop: auto_stop,
dir,
cron_schedule,
cron_retrigger,
retry,
retry_count: 0,
ready_delay: ready_delay.or(Some(3)),
ready_output,
ready_http,
ready_port,
wait_ready: true,
depends,
})
.await
{
Ok((started, exit_code)) => (!started.is_empty(), exit_code),
Err(e) => {
error!("Failed to start daemon {}: {}", id, e);
(false, Some(1))
}
};
// Only report success if daemon was actually started
if !actually_started {
warn!("Daemon {} was not restarted (may still be running)", id);
return (id, None, Some(1));
}
(id, Some(start_time), exit_code)
});
tasks.push(task);
}
// Wait for all tasks to complete
let mut any_failed = false;
let mut successful_daemons: Vec<(String, DateTime<Local>)> = Vec::new();
for task in tasks {
match task.await {
Ok((id, start_time, exit_code)) => {
if exit_code.is_some() {
any_failed = true;
} else if let Some(start_time) = start_time {
successful_daemons.push((id, start_time));
}
}
Err(e) => {
error!("Task panicked: {}", e);
any_failed = true;
}
}
}
// Show startup logs for successful daemons (unless --quiet)
if !self.quiet {
for (id, start_time) in successful_daemons {
if let Err(e) = print_startup_logs(&id, start_time) {
debug!("Failed to print startup logs for {}: {}", id, e);
}
}
}
if any_failed {
std::process::exit(1);
}
Ok(())
}
}
